Pros
The engineering culture is really good and the kind of opportunities you get to learn technology is also great. If you are fresher then don't even think twice about this aspect. What I liked most was the no BS attitude towards engineering, imagine working with great colleagues who deeply understand the things they work on. The compensation is also way above average and it might not be as crazy as some "start-ups" that are cropping up but if you add value the % raises and bonus at year end that you get is really good.
Cons
Don't expect any fancy food/other amenities, though the basics are covered. You are expected to work hard as its a fast paced environment and it might be a good/bad thing depending on your personality type and work ethics. But if you are looking for a 9-5 don't even think about this place. It has all the craziness of a start-up that's trying to figure out how to do things and this might get overwhelming for some people.
